Pipedija - tautosaka, gandai, kliedesiai ir jokios tiesos! Durniausia wiki enciklopedija durnapedija!
Harvardo architektūra: Skirtumas tarp puslapio versijų
(Naujas puslapis: '''Harvardo architektūra''' - viena iš dviejų pagrindinių procesorių architektūrų, kurioje duomenys arba signalai yra atskirti nuo programos, kuri tuos duomenis arba signalus apdirba. Harvardo architektūra buvo taikoma ankstyviausiuose kompiuteriuose, tačiau dėl įvairių priežasčių nelabai pasiteisino. Praktikoje ne visada įmanoma išvengti duomenų ir kodo atskyrimo, o dar blogiau - toksai atskyrimas labai apriboja ir kai kurias programavimo...) |
|||
| 1 eilutė: | 1 eilutė: | ||
'''Harvardo architektūra''' - viena iš dviejų pagrindinių [[procesoriai|procesorių]] architektūrų, kurioje duomenys arba signalai yra atskirti nuo programos, kuri tuos duomenis arba signalus apdirba. | '''Harvardo architektūra''' - viena iš dviejų pagrindinių [[procesoriai|procesorių]] architektūrų, kurioje duomenys arba signalai yra atskirti nuo programos, kuri tuos duomenis arba signalus apdirba. | ||
Harvardo architektūra buvo taikoma ankstyviausiuose kompiuteriuose, tačiau dėl įvairių priežasčių nelabai pasiteisino. Praktikoje ne visada įmanoma išvengti duomenų ir kodo atskyrimo, o dar blogiau - toksai atskyrimas labai apriboja ir kai kurias programavimo galimybes. Kitą vertus, tokia architektūra kartais leidžia dirbti juntamai greičiau, nei Von Neuman architektūra. Bet problemos lieka visvien didelės. | Harvardo architektūra buvo taikoma ankstyviausiuose kompiuteriuose, tačiau dėl įvairių priežasčių nelabai pasiteisino. Praktikoje ne visada įmanoma išvengti duomenų ir kodo atskyrimo, o dar blogiau - toksai atskyrimas labai apriboja ir kai kurias programavimo galimybes. Kitą vertus, tokia architektūra kartais leidžia dirbti juntamai greičiau, nei [[Von Neuman architektūra]]. Bet problemos lieka visvien didelės. | ||
Taigi, šiais laikais Harvardo architektūra pasitaiko daugiausiai specializuotuose [[procesoriai|procesoriuose]], pvz., kai kurie [[signaliniai procesoriai|signaliniuose procesoriuose]]. | Taigi, šiais laikais Harvardo architektūra pasitaiko daugiausiai specializuotuose [[procesoriai|procesoriuose]], pvz., kai kurie [[signaliniai procesoriai|signaliniuose procesoriuose]]. | ||
01:53, 3 sausio 2023 versija
Harvardo architektūra - viena iš dviejų pagrindinių procesorių architektūrų, kurioje duomenys arba signalai yra atskirti nuo programos, kuri tuos duomenis arba signalus apdirba.
Harvardo architektūra buvo taikoma ankstyviausiuose kompiuteriuose, tačiau dėl įvairių priežasčių nelabai pasiteisino. Praktikoje ne visada įmanoma išvengti duomenų ir kodo atskyrimo, o dar blogiau - toksai atskyrimas labai apriboja ir kai kurias programavimo galimybes. Kitą vertus, tokia architektūra kartais leidžia dirbti juntamai greičiau, nei Von Neuman architektūra. Bet problemos lieka visvien didelės.
Taigi, šiais laikais Harvardo architektūra pasitaiko daugiausiai specializuotuose procesoriuose, pvz., kai kurie signaliniuose procesoriuose.
Bene labiausiai išplitęs procesorius, turintis Harvardo architektūrą - tai PIC, naudojamas daugelyje mikrokontrolerių.